About The Book

“Adeline and The Friendship Treehouse” by Bee Foster is a children’s book that aims to take the readers into a world full of adventure and imagination. The plot is set in the Magical Forest, and the adventures of three likable characters are described: a bumblebee named Bumper who is always full of joy; a young girl named Adeline; and a pony called Lolli who is as cheerful as the surrounding nature. Their adventures are vividly described on every page, and the focus is on creativity, exploration, and aesthetic harmony.

The friends go on a picnic trip, which is led by the adventurous spirit of Adeline, hence depicting the usefulness of teamwork and the world being awe-inspiring. Examples of a bright forest encourage the readers to understand that everything is possible.
